如何从Yeshopy.com网站的phpMyAdmin数据库中删除所有存储的数据,包括已删除主题的CSS?

问题描述 投票:0回答:1

我使用了多个免费主题来检查网站的性能,发现被删除的主题的CSS、图像和其他数据没有从数据库中删除,这些数据破坏了网站主题。

请指导我如何从Yeshopy.com网站的phpMyAdmin数据库中删除所有存储的数据,包括已删除主题的CSS?

T 试图从 Yeshopy.com 网站的 phpMyAdmin 数据库删除所有数据,包括 css、html?

wordpress phpmyadmin
1个回答
0
投票

要通过 phpMyAdmin 从基于 WordPress 的网站(如 Yeshopy.com)的数据库中删除所有存储的数据,包括 CSS、图像和已删除主题的其他元素,请仔细执行以下步骤。请确保在继续之前备份您的数据库,以防止意外数据丢失。

步骤

  1. 访问phpMyAdmin • 登录到您的主机控制面板(cPanel 或任何类似的控制面板)。 • 在数据库部分下查找phpMyAdmin 工具并单击它。 • 选择 WordPress 安装所使用的数据库(通常命名为 wp_database)。
  2. 识别主题数据

大多数主题数据存储在与 WordPress 相关的特定数据库表中。以下是可以存储主题数据的公共区域: • wp_options 表:此表存储主题设置、CSS 和自定义配置。 • 运行以下查询来识别与主题相关的行: SELECT * FROM wp_options WHERE option_name LIKE '%theme%';

• 查找与已删除主题相关的选项,例如 theme_mods_yourtheme 或任何类似内容,然后将其删除: 从 wp_options 中删除 option_name = 'theme_mods_yourtheme';

• wp_postmeta 表:某些主题在此表中存储元数据,例如图像路径或自定义 CSS。 • 运行此查询以查找任何与主题相关的数据: SELECT * FROM wp_postmeta WHERE meta_key LIKE '%yourtheme%';

• 删除这些行 从 wp_postmeta 删除,其中 meta_key = 'yourtheme_key';

• wp_posts 表:如果主题添加了自定义帖子、滑块或图像引用,它们将位于此处。 • 通过以下方式检查主题相关的帖子: SELECT * FROM wp_posts WHERE post_content LIKE '%yourtheme%'; • 如果发现任何不必要的帖子,请删除。

  1. 手动删除剩余的 CSS 文件 虽然通过上述步骤将清除与主题相关的数据库条目,但您可能仍然需要从服务器手动删除任何 CSS、图像文件或其他资源: • 登录文件管理器(cPanel 或通过FTP)。 • 导航至wp-content/themes/ 文件夹。 • 确保已删除主题的主题文件夹已完全删除。

  2. 清理瞬变和缓存 删除主题后清理剩余的瞬态和缓存数据是个好主意: • 您可以使用 WP-Sweep 等插件或在 phpMyAdmin 中运行此 SQL 查询来清除瞬态:

  3. 测试您的网站 清除数据库和文件后: • 访问您的站点以确保主题按预期运行。 • 检查是否有任何剩余的布局或 CSS 问题。

通过执行这些步骤,您应该能够从已删除的主题中完全删除剩余数据。始终确保您有备份,以防出现问题。

© www.soinside.com 2019 - 2024. All rights reserved.